Studies on anti-Helicobacter pylori agents. Part 1: Benzyloxyisoquinoline derivatives

Yoshida, Yoshiki,Barrett, David,Azami, Hidenori,Morinaga, Chizu,Matsumoto, Satoru,Matsumoto, Yoshimi,Takasugi, Hisashi

, p. 2647 - 2666 (2011/05/18)

The synthesis and optimization of the anti-Helicobacter pylori activity of a novel series of benzyloxyisoquinoline derivatives that was discovered by a random screening process, are described. In the in vitro assay, compound 10c containing a 3-acetamido-2,6-dichlorobenzyl substituent was found to have extremely potent activity against H. pylori and no activity against other common bacteria. The anti-H. pylori activity of 10c was superior to that of amoxicillin (AMPC) (1) and clarithromycin (CAM) (2). However, 10c did not show in vivo efficacy in a mouse infection model; a feature attributed to the lack of strong bactericidal activity at short contact times. (C) 1999 Elsevier Science Ltd.

Discovery of a novel benzyloxyisoquinoline derivative with potent anti- Helicobacter pylori activity

Yoshida, Yoshiki,Barrett, David,Azami, Hidenori,Morinaga, Chizu,Matsumoto, Yoshimi,Takasugi, Hisashi

, p. 1897 - 1902 (2007/10/03)

The synthesis and in vitro optimization of the anti-Helicobacter pylori activity of a novel series of benzyloxyisoquinoline derivatives discovered by a random screening process, are described. FR180102 (7f), having a 3- acetamido-2,6-dichlorobenzyl moiety, was found to have extremely potent activity against H. pylori and no effect against a series of common Gram- positive and Gram-negative bacteria.
